Reloading them are tough. Once I figured out that I have to get a consistent grip on the mag, and not moving the gun to a specific position, it helped me reload a lot more consistently. I don't really care about how FAST I reload, but about how many times I can reload consistently. Something I learned from a dinner with a couple National contenders was consistency and transitions. If I am doing a standards I know I need to nail a reload and the movement of my feet and the grip on my hands, angle of the gun, etc. So in that case I am putting more thought into my reload, and can usually nail it a lot smoother and quicker. If I am just leaving a position I am not thinking about reloading, I am thinking of the front sight and where I am going next if that makes sense. Either way I am just working on a good consistent grip on the magazine once my hand leaves the gun to retrieve the next magazine. Once this occurs and I have a good grip on the mag I can with about 90-93% consistency get a smooth 1.0-1.2 reload to a 7 yard target. Further than that and its usually 1.5 seconds.
